No, the exact opposite! When it's omitted or `"*"`, then step 3 allows initialValue to be unspecified without raising an error; in that case, the initial value is set to an initially invalid value, just like any unregistered custom property. If the spec is in any way unclear on this point, let me know, but as far as I can tell this behavior is completely specified. -- GitHub Notification of comment by tabatkins Please view or discuss this issue at https://github.com/w3c/css-houdini-drafts/issues/286#issuecomment-323849215 using your GitHub account
